Another kind of FAMily.

Foster Alumni Mentors (FAM) creates a community of belonging and a network of support for those who have experienced foster care.

CONNECT

We connect with foster alumni to “normalize” life, showing them that they are not alone, and that they have an entire community of support.

INSPIRE

We inspire foster alumni to believe in themselves, introducing them to other alumni who are following their dreams and achieving their goals.

EMPOWER

We empower foster alumni by providing tools that will support them in reaching their full potential and creating their unique path to success.

Our Why

Nationwide, over 20,000 youth are emancipated from the foster care system each year.

Imagine being 17 years old with little to no connections to family or people who care about you. Who supports you with securing a safe place to live, applying for a job, preparing meals, managing your money, or finding a doctor? Who comes to your aid when your car won’t start or stops by when you’ve had a tough day? Who do you turn to with questions of how to become an “adult”?

Now imagine being in your 20s, 30s, 40s or older, navigating parenthood without support or trying to figure out what you want to do or what your life goals are. Who provides guidance and encouragement for raising your kids or seeking your dreams? Who do you process your foster care experiences with and their impact on you today? Who is there to help quiet the doubts, believe in your gifts, and cheer you on no matter what?

For many of those who have experienced foster care, a “who” is hard to come by and would make all the difference. At Foster Alumni Mentors (FAM), we help with “who” through providing a range of peer-to-peer activities and individualized, staff-guided support.

We believe that with dedicated access to resources for connection, inspiration and empowerment, foster care alumni can create wildly fruitful futures and be some of the greatest contributors to our community, near and far.

Alumni Highlight

Meet Starla

I’m Starla! I’m a 32-year-old mom to a bunch of girls! I was in foster care starting at 15 and aged out at 18. I decided to follow my dream and recently graduated from cosmetology school and am waiting to sit for my licensing. I love all things hair and makeup! I chose this industry because it’s a really awesome way to get to connect with people and give them, not only a space to come and relax, but also lend a listening ear.
I have cried a few times with my clients. I just love people and truly believe in putting good into anyone I come across.

Where are you from?
I call Grand Junction home
Hobbies, family life, anything you would like to share so that we can know you a bit better?
I have many totally unfinished hobbies, between my boyfriend and I, we have 5 girls and a very wide age range. I’ve lived in many different places and, although I call GJ home, I’m terrified to drive in the mountains here!  My goal with my license is to be able to provide services for youth currently in care.
Job/school
Intellitec cosmetology graduate 
5 fun facts about yourself.
I have a major fear of fish, I’ve had literal nightmares about them chasing me. 
I’m often the quiet one in the room but that changes when we know one another. 
I love nature and oftentimes forget to leave my house with shoes on in the summer.
I have dreams of one day writing a book! 
Halloween is easily my favorite holiday.
